1. Adjustable Height
One of the standout features of a quality phlebotomy table is its adjustable height. Healthcare professionals come in varying heights, and patients may also have different requirements based on their physical condition. An adjustable table allows for:
- Improved Ergonomics: Helps reduce strain on the provider’s back and arms.
- Customized Patient Positioning: Offers optimal positioning for patients, ensuring their comfort during procedures.
- Accessibility: Facilitates easier access for individuals with mobility constraints.
2. Comfort Padding
Patient comfort is crucial in any medical setting, especially during blood draws. Look for tables with high-quality comfort padding. Features to consider include:
- Thickness: More padding minimizes discomfort during procedures.
- Material: Soft, breathable materials prevent skin irritation and enhance overall comfort.
- Removability: Ensure covers are removable and washable to maintain hygiene.
3.Stability and Durability
The stability of a phlebotomy table is paramount. Patients need to feel secure while undergoing procedures. Key aspects include:
- Sturdy Construction: Made of durable materials like steel or reinforced metal to withstand daily use.
- Non-Slip Base: A non-slip base provides additional safety for both patients and practitioners.
- Weight Capacity: Ensure the table can accommodate various patients for best results.
4.Easy-to-Clean Surfaces
Hygiene cannot be understated in clinical settings. Look for tables with easy-to-clean surfaces. The following elements make a table hygienic:
- non-Porous Materials: Use materials that resist contamination.
- Smooth Surfaces: Tables with minimal grooves and seams are easier to disinfect.
- Antimicrobial Coatings: Some materials now come with antimicrobial properties, enhancing infection control.
5. Additional Features
while the basic functionalities are essential, additional features can greatly enhance the efficiency of the phlebotomy table:
- Integrated Armrests: Armrests offer additional support, making patients feel more secure.
- Storage Options: Built-in drawers or shelves for storing essential supplies can save time during procedures.
- Portability: Lightweight tables or those with wheels make it easy to move in multi-use environments.
